Posts Tagged with Rygor Commercials

EvoBus Daimler UK sells London centre

EvoBus Daimler UK sells London centre

By busandcoachbuyer -

Rygor Commercials has made its first move into the bus and coach market by acquiring the southern aftersales centre of EvoBus Daimler UK at Southall,...